http://venturingbsa.com/scouting.d/fact.sheets.d/02-505.html WebSep 9, 2024 · Apparently, only five of the world's 197 countries do not have Scouting: Andorra, Cuba, North Korea, Laos, and Vatican City. A sixth country, China (People's Republic), has no Scouting except in the former colonies of Hong Kong and Macau. Approximately 1 out of every 139 people on earth is involved in Scouting.

Scouting / Guiding in India before 1950: The first Scout Troop in India, consisting of Indian Boys, was formed by a Scottish Missionary, in the Central Provinces (present Madhya Pradesh) in 1908. However, the troop was disbanded in 1910.
